🔷 What is Premature Ejaculation?

Premature ejaculation refers to:

  • ejaculation that occurs sooner than desired

  • reduced sense of control

  • distress for the individual and/or partner

It may occur:

  • from the beginning of sexual activity (lifelong)

  • or develop later (acquired)

 

🔷 Why does it happen?

Premature ejaculation is not simply a matter of “control.”
It is linked to how the body, anxiety, and the nervous system function.

 

🔹 Psychological causes

  • Performance anxiety

  • Over-arousal

  • Fear of failure

  • Lack of experience

  • Guilt or shame around sex

 

🔹 Learned patterns

In many men, a pattern develops:

👉 Fast arousal → fast ejaculation

This may be learned through:

  • rapid masturbation habits

  • pressure to “finish quickly”

  • anxiety

 

🔹 Relationship factors

  • Lack of communication

  • Pressure from a partner

  • Emotional distance

👉 In many cases, this can also be addressed through couples therapy

 

🔹 Physical factors

In some cases, there may be:

  • Hormonal factors

  • Increased nervous system sensitivity

 

🔷 The vicious cycle

  • Rapid ejaculation

  • Frustration

  • Anxiety about the next time

  • Even faster arousal

  • Repetition

👉 The cycle becomes reinforced

 

🔷 How Sex Therapy Helps

Therapy focuses on:

✔ increasing control
✔ reducing anxiety
✔ regulating arousal
✔ improving confidence

🔹 It may include:

  • Psychoeducation

  • Ejaculation control techniques

  • Exercises (e.g., start–stop, sensate focus)

  • Anxiety management

  • Partner involvement

 

🔷 Practical techniques

✔ Learning to recognize arousal levels
✔ Pacing and rhythm control
✔ Breathing and relaxation
✔ Gradual increase of endurance

👉 These techniques are learned and applied progressively

 

🔷 Common myths about premature ejaculation

❌ “There is no solution”
✔ Effective techniques exist

❌ “It’s about strength or control”
✔ It is about training and regulation

❌ “Something is wrong with me”
✔ It is very common and treatable

🔷 Why do I finish quickly?

Premature ejaculation is often linked to over-arousal and anxiety.
When the body becomes activated quickly and arousal is not regulated, ejaculation occurs sooner than desired.
